#d24fa2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d24fa2 is composed of 82.4% red, 31%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.4%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 322 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 56.7%. #d24fa2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#a50045.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d24fa2 color description : Moderate pink.
#d24fa2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d24fa2 has RGB values of R:210, G:79,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.23,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13782946.

Shades and Tints of #d24fa2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0308 is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d24fa2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#978b92 is the less saturated color, while #fd25ad is the most saturated one.
